billiardsforum on 2/22/2026 10:13:12 AMI am having trouble with this one only because of the logo. According to the Viking cue archives, the only series which had a plain "Viking" logo (without the "USA" and without the surrounding oval) was the P series, but this cue isn't part of that.
Your exact model (apart from the logo version) was seen in the Viking Millennium series circa 1997-2004, as the Viking VM17-C pool cue (where the "C" represents the copper color). The Viking VM17 cue was available in 3 standard colors, and copper was one of them.
It's MSRP was $420, but online retailers commonly sold it for just under $300 at the time.
But again, the cues from the Viking "Millennium" series typically had a "USA" stamped under the word "Viking" - whereas yours does not.
Regardless, you can treat it as a Viking VM17-C in terms of model and value.
